
Wet and Cool in the East this Memorial Day Weekend; Well Above Normal Temperatures in the Northern Plains
A wet Memorial Day weekend is in store for the East, with widespread rainfall of 1 to more than 2 inches expected from the Gulf Coast to southern New England. Well above normal temperatures are forecast to build across the northern Plains.
